Current form — Villarreal v. Barcelona
Villarreal in nice flow.
One can't really point a finger on the results for Villarreal in past weeks, as they have performed according to their level. Villarreal have been all in their last 3 matches, which brought added 4 points to their tally. They claimed a 1-0 win against Getafe, before drawing 1-1 with Celta Vigo. This little streak came to an end, when Manchester United proved too strong in a 2-0 defeat for Villarreal.
Barcelona paddling along
Results have been pretty much up to scratch in recent matches for Barcelona, who have performed more or less according to expectations. Barcelona go into their upcoming match unbeaten in their previous 3 matches, which started off with a 3-3 draw against Celta Vigo. They went on to beat Espanyol by 1-0, before sharing the spoils with Benfica in a 0-0 draw.

Villarreal v. Barcelona — fixture history
The last time the two teams faced off against each other, Barcelona came away as 1-2 winners. In was a match played at Estadio de la Ceramica back in April 2021 in the La Liga. This time round, betting on Barcelona will get you odds 2.55, meaning the bookies predict, they are in with a 39% chance of beating Villarreal. You can get a price of 2.60, should you wish to bet your money on Villarreal. Villarreal enter the match against Barcelona with a 0-2-8 record in their previous 10 encounters in the La Liga. This amounts to a 0% winning ratio for Villarreal, with Barcelona victorious in 80% of the last 10 encounters. The past 10 matches between Villarreal and Barcelona have largely been entertaining matches. With more than two goals coming out 7 times in these encounters, it is only natural to look for goals this coming Saturday.
